The mother of the bride was so sweet and happy for her daughter,  that she, along with the cake, was just tickled pink.  The feminine confection was a Meyer lemon cake filled with lemon curd and Swiss meringue butter cream all wrapped up with white, light, and dark pink fondant.

my friend Shawnelle.  She came up with the coolest party theme- Mad Science Experiments!  Seriously what nine year old boy wouldn’t want to blow up mentos and diet coke at his birthday party.   She commissioned this lab flask to go with the carbonated ice cream they were going to make.   It was hollowed out on top so that a cup with dry ice could make the cake “smoke”.  Hopefully,  I can get a picture  of it in action later, but for now, here is the non-smoking version.

Can you tell this was a fun party?  I mean, look at all that ice cream!   It was fun.  My nephew turned two and is very much into CARS right now, hence the Radiator Springs style Lightning McQueen (if you understood that you must have a little boy or two in your life).  The flavors were child friendly too, vanilla cake with milk chocolate ganache.
